When to fly

The weather in Oruro is characterized by an arid climate with a distinct rainy season from December to March, peaking in February. The warmest month is November, with an average high of 19.2°C, while the coldest nights occur in June and July, when temperatures can drop below freezing.

From a budget perspective, the most affordable month to fly is January, with ticket prices starting AED 267. In the middle of the year, such as in July, prices also remain accessible, starting AED 277, allowing you to plan your trip without overspending.

June and July are considered the optimal time to visit, as these months see the least rainfall, which is ideal for sightseeing, and flight prices remain stable and low. It is recommended to avoid February due to the high likelihood of prolonged rain.

Frequently asked questions about the Cochabamba — Oruro flight

How long is the flight from Cochabamba to Oruro?

Given the short distance of 119 km, a direct flight takes an average of about 30–40 minutes, making it the fastest way to travel between these cities.

Which airlines fly this route?

Regular flights between these cities are operated by Bolivia's national carrier, Boliviana de Aviación (OB).

Are there direct flights?

Yes, there are direct flights on this route, allowing you to reach your destination without any layovers.

How much is the cheapest ticket?

Ticket prices are dynamic and depend on the departure date; you can find the current minimum prices for the upcoming year in the low-price calendar on this page.

Do Russian citizens need a visa for Bolivia?

Citizens of Russia do not require a visa to visit Bolivia for tourism for up to 90 days within any 180-day period.

Which airport does the flight arrive at?

Flights from Cochabamba arrive at Oruro's Juan Mendoza International Airport (ORU).
